Very briefly, WP is horrible in PvP. That said, you should probably just ignore PvP when planning toons, since it's basically completely dead anyway. In PvE, fire/WP is very good. Fire is great, but it does have one negative aspect: zero mitigation. With WP that can hurt, since sometimes you could use a few seconds of not being attacked to regen lost health. Sets with knockback, end drain, etc can help with that, but fire is just pure damage. Still, you definitely won't feel useless anywhere in PvE. In PvP you will get destroyed though, but it's so ridiculously broken, it's not worth the extra effort of planning for it.
